THE KING IS ALMOST HERE!
(Don’t Tire Out Or Flag in Zeal)
📖“Not lagging in diligence, fervent in spirit, serving the Lord.” (Romans 12:11)
We can see clearly from the Scriptures and events in the world today that we’re in the final days before the Rapture of the Church. In other words, “our King is coming!” This isn’t the time to loaf around; there’s a lot the Lord wants to do through you in the short time left. You’ve got to work with the mentality that His appearing could be any minute and be very passionate for the Gospel. Work hard to ensure its spread and impact around the world .
As the Scriptures tell us, the Antichrist will only be given three-and-a-half years for the Great Tribulation. It’s going to be a period of intense trouble, worse than the world has ever experienced and will ever experience (Matthew 24:21), and it’ll be worldwide in scope. The Lord said, “If those days had not been cut short, no one would survive, but for the sake of the elect those days will be shortened” (Matthew 24:22 NIV). Imagine the magnitude of evil and destruction that could be perpetrated by the Antichrist that would warrant a divine shortening. That also tells us something: We too can do a lot of good within a short time; we can shake up this world!
It begins with you giving more attention to prayer, especially praying for the impact of the Gospel worldwide in these last days. This is very important; it’s not just about you; it’s about the future of our world. Before the Rapture, we’ve got to dominate this world like never before! Jesus isn’t planning to “snatch” us out of this world as though we’ve been victims. Remember that He overcame the world. He’s coming for a victorious church, a triumphant church. Glory to God!
